I developed a custom card reader for contact and contactless smart card, this card reader is expected to run in an outdoor environment and with a temperature up to 70°C
I have issues when the ambient temperature goes over 50°C with contact cards.
The issues are :
- ATR is corrupted or
- During APDU exchanges, frames are corrupted.
The NXP data sheet says the PN7462 should work up to 85°C
The firmware of the reader comes from the NXP example PN7462AU_ex_phExCcid where the 2 temperature sensors of the PN7462 are disabled.
